Validating epub returns warning

I just put my epub draft (which is now working in all devices) through the validator at:

http://validator.idpf.org/

and it returned a "Warning" with the following message:

"item (iTunesMetadata.plist) exists in the zip file, but is not declared in the OPF file"

Any ideas what this means? And should I worry?

I'm afraid I don't quite yet know where to start when it comes to editing anything in the zip file. Mainly I'm not sure what to use to do this, and how I would go about making sure the revisions take, i.e. saving the new document and re-zipping(?) the file.

I'm on a Macbook Pro, running Snow Leopard, if it helps.
